Cement top up: Nemo Field
THE PROBLEM
Earlier wells in the vicinity of the Nemo 7/4-2 well (Offshore Norway) required remedial cementing. The requirement to minimise lateral deflection of the riser/conductor system to limit the load gave a requirement for a cement top up system to ensure that the 30 inch conductor is fully cemented to the seabed.
THE SOLUTION
Claxton was asked to provide technical advice and guidance for the design, specification and manufacture of a cement top up system. A secondary cementing system was designed to be installed at the same time as the conductor to enable cement filling of possible voids in the annulus between the conductor and 36” well hole.
Due to the well depth the cement top up system was fixed to the 30 inch conductor prior to installation and run through the 36 inch hole section to a depth of approx. 30m below the mud line. The system was connected to the cementing unit topside by means of a 1 ½ inch nominal bore (NB) grouting hose deployed on a powered umbilical reel. An ROV disconnect was used to connect the hose subsea.
THE RESULT
The Claxton Cement Top Up system enabled the customer to perform a secondary cement job offline saving a significant amount of rig time and ensuring a good cement job. This gave the customer a better solution to months of cementing difficulties.
